Default question on valve cover gaskets - 92 sc 400

I need to install new valve cover gaskets on my 92 sc400. I believe i need to take off the intake before i get to them. Is there anything else i need to replace while changing the valve cover gaskets such as any other gaskets? Thx.

Default Valve covers

Messy,

You DO NOT need to remove the intake to R&R the valve cover gasket. Get on the net a search for ALLDATA. They provide the complete service manual for your specific car for $24 a year. You can go to Valve cover R&R and get every step yo have to go through with pictures to do the job....any job. I can not imagine 24 bucks better spent.
